Lawson–Simons conjecture for submanifolds in spheres

Let be an -dimensional closed submanifold satisfying
where is the second fundamental form. Lawson–Simons conjecture. The mean curvature flow with initial value converges to a round point or a totally geodesic sphere. In particular, is diffeomorphic to . The source presents this as a special case motivated by the minimum of the pinching function and explicitly states that the Lawson–Simons conjecture remains open.

Primary source
Li Lei and Hongwei Xu, “Mean curvature flow of arbitrary codimension in spheres and sharp differentiable sphere theorem”, arXiv:1506.06371 (2021).
